Babereh-ye Sofla (Persian: بابره سفلي)[a] is a village in Harzandat-e Sharqi Rural District of the Central District in Marand County, East Azerbaijan province, Iran.

Demographics

Population

At the time of the 2006 National Census, the village's population was 505 in 136 households.[4] The following census in 2011 counted 423 people in 136 households.[5] The 2016 census measured the population of the village as 347 people in 115 households.[2]
